English | 简体中文 | 繁體中文 | Русский язык | Français | Español | Português | Deutsch | 日本語 | 한국어 | Italiano | بالعربية
PHP MySQLi 함수는 MySQLi 데이터베이스 서버에 접근할 수 있습니다. PHP는 MySQLi와 함께 사용할 수 있습니다. 4.1.13또는 그 이상 버전과 함께 사용됩니다.
MySQLi 확장은 PHP 5.0.0 버전에서 도입되었으며, MySQLi 로컬 드라이버는 PHP에 포함되어 있습니다 5.3.0 버전에서
버전-그 함수를 지원하는 PHP의 가장 오래된 버전을 나타냅니다
순번 | 함수 이름 | 함수 설명 | 버전 |
---|---|---|---|
1 | mysqli_affected_rows() | 마지막 SELECT, INSERT, UPDATE, REPLACE 또는 DELETE 쿼리에서 영향을 받은 행 수를 반환합니다 | 4 |
2 | mysqli_autocommit() | 자동 커밋 데이터베이스 변경을 열거나 닫습니다 | 4.3.0 |
3 | mysqli_begin_transaction() | MySQL 트랜잭션을 시작하는 데 사용됩니다 | 4.3.0 |
4 | mysqli_change_user() | 현재/지정된 데이터베이스 연결의 사용자 | 4.3.0 |
5 | mysqli_character_set_name() | 현재 데이터베이스의 기본 문자 집합을 검색하는 데 사용됩니다 | 4.3.0 |
6 | mysqli_close() | MySQLi 연결을 닫는 데 사용됩니다 | 4 |
7 | mysqli_commit() | 그것은 데이터베이스 변경을 저장하는 데 사용됩니다 | 5 |
8 | mysqli_connect() | MySQLi 서버와의 연결을 열습니다 | 4 |
9 | mysqli_connect_errno() | 그것은 마지막 연결에서 오류 코드를 반환합니다 | 5 |
10 | mysqli_connect_error() | 그것은 마지막 연결에서 오류 설명을 반환합니다 | 5 |
11 | mysqli_debug() | 디버그 작업을 수행하는 데 사용됩니다 | 5 |
12 | mysqli_dump_debug_info() | 디버그 정보를 로그에 기록하는 데 사용됩니다 | 5 |
13 | mysqli_errno() | 그것은 마지막 문장의 최신 오류 코드를 반환합니다 | 4 |
14 | mysqli_error() | 그것은 마지막 문장의 최신 오류 설명을 반환합니다 | 4 |
15 | mysqli_error_list() | 그것은 마지막 문장에서 오류 목록을 반환합니다 | 4 |
16 | mysqli_field_count() | 그것은 최근 쿼리의 열 수를 반환합니다/필드 수. | 5 |
17 | mysqli_get_charset() | 그것은 문자 집합 객체를 반환합니다. | 4 |
18 | mysqli_get_client_info() | 그것은 MySQL 클라이언트 라이브러리 버전을 반환합니다. | 5 |
19 | mysqli_get_client_stats() | 그것은 클라이언트 각 프로세스에 대한 통계 정보를 반환합니다. | 5 |
20 | mysqli_get_client_version() | 그것은 MySQLi 클라이언트 라이브러리 버전을 반환합니다. | 5.1.0 |
21 | mysqli_get_connection_stats() | 그것은 클라이언트 연결에 대한 통계 정보를 반환합니다. | 5 |
22 | mysqli_get_host_info() | 이는 MySQLi 서버의 호스트 이름과 연결 유형을 반환합니다. | 5 |
23 | mysqli_get_proto_info() | 이는 MySQLi 프로토콜 버전 정보를 반환합니다. | 5 |
24 | mysqli_get_server_info() | 이는 MySQLi 서버 정보를 반환합니다. | 5 |
25 | mysqli_get_server_version() | 이는 MySQLi 서버 버전을 반환합니다. | 5 |
26 | mysqli_get_warnings() | 이는 마지막으로 실행된 쿼리에서 생성된 오류를 반환합니다. | 5 |
27 | mysqli_info() | 이는 최근 실행된 쿼리에 대한 정보를 반환합니다. | 5 |
28 | mysqli_init() | 이는 mysqli_real_connect() 함수와 함께 사용되는 객체를 반환합니다. | 5 |
29 | mysqli_insert_id() | 이는 마지막 쿼리의 ID를 반환합니다. | 5 |
30 | mysqli_kill() | 이 함수는 process에 의해 생성된 스레드를 서버에서 죽입니다.-id 파라미터가 지정한 MySQLi 스레드. | 5 |
31 | mysqli_more_results() | 이 함수는 다중 쿼리가 더 많은 결과가 있는지 확인합니다. | 5 |
32 | mysqli_multi_query() | 이는 쿼리와 데이터베이스를 세미콜론으로 분리했습니다. | 5 |
33 | mysqli_next_result() | 이는 mysqli_multi_query()에 다음 결과 집합을 준비합니다. | 5 |
34 | mysqli_options() | 이는 연결 옵션을 설정하고 연결 설정을 변경합니다. | 5 |
35 | mysqli_ping() | 이는 서버 연결을 ping하고 연결이 끊어지면 서버로 다시 연결합니다. | 5 |
36 | mysqli_prepare() | 이는 데이터베이스에 MySQL 준비된 쿼리(파라미터 표시자를 포함)를 수행합니다. | 5 |
37 | mysqli_query() | 이는 데이터베이스에 쿼리를 수행합니다. | 5 |
38 | mysqli_real_connect() | 이 함수는 MySQL 서버로 새로운 연결을 열습니다. | 5 |
39 | mysqli_real_escape_string() | 이 함수는 SQL 문의 문자열을 특수 문자로 대체합니다. | 5 |
40 | mysqli_real_query() | 이 함수는 SQL 쿼리를 실행합니다. | 5 |
41 | mysqli_refresh() | 이 함수는 테이블이나 캐시를 새로 고침하거나 복제 서버 정보를 재설정합니다. | 5 |
42 | mysqli_rollback() | 이 함수는 지정된 데이터베이스 연결의 현재 트랜잭션을 롤백합니다. | 5 |
43 | mysqli_select_db() | 이 함수는 기본 데이터베이스를 변경합니다. | 5 |
44 | mysqli_set_charset() | 이 함수는 기본 문자 집합을 설정합니다. | 5 |
45 | mysqli_sqlstate() | 이 함수는 마지막 오류의 SQLSTATE 오류 코드를 반환합니다. | 5 |
46 | mysqli_ssl_set() | 이 함수는 SSL 연결을 생성합니다. | 5 |
47 | mysqli_stat() | 이 함수는 현재 시스템 상태를 반환합니다. | 5 |
48 | mysqli_stmt_init() | 이 함수는 문장을 초기화하고 mysqli_stmt_prepare()에 적합한 객체를 반환합니다. | 5 |
49 | mysqli_thread__id() | 이 함수는 현재의 연결 스레드 ID를 반환합니다. | 5 |
50 | mysqli_thread_safe() | 이 함수는 클라이언트 라이브러리가 스레드 안전하게 컴파일되었는지 확인하는 데 사용됩니다(thread-safe) | 5 |
51 | mysqli_use_result() | mysqli_real_query()를 사용한 마지막 쿼리에서 결과 집합의 검색을 초기화합니다. | 5 |
52 | mysqli_warning_count() | 그는 마지막으로 실행된 쿼리에서 생성된 오류 수를 반환합니다. | 5 |
53 | mysqli_data_seek() | 그는 내부 결과 포인터를 이동하는 데 사용됩니다. | 4 |
54 | mysqli_fetch_all() | 그는 모든 결과 행을 가져오고 결과 집합을 연관 배열로 반환하는 데 사용됩니다 | 4 |
55 | mysqli_fetch_array() | 그는 결과 행을 연관 배열로 가져오는 데 사용됩니다 | 5 |
56 | mysqli_fetch_assoc() | 그는 결과 행을 연관 배열로 가져오는 데 사용됩니다. | 5.3 |
57 | mysqli_fetch_field() | 그는 결과 집합의 다음 열을 객체로 반환하는 데 사용됩니다. | 4 |
58 | mysqli_fetch_field_direct() | 그는 객체 형식으로 지정된 열을 반환합니다./필드(정수 파라미터로) 정의 정보. | 4 |
59 | mysqli_fetch_fields() | 그는 객체 배열을 반환하는 데 사용됩니다. | 4 |
60 | mysqli_fetch_lengths() | 그는 결과 집합에서의 필드 길이를 반환하는 데 사용됩니다. | 4 |
61 | mysqli_fetch_object() | 그는 객체를 반환합니다. | 5 |
62 | mysqli_fetch_row() | 그는 문자 배열 형식으로 결과 집합의 현재 행의 내용을 반환합니다. | 5 |
63 | mysqli_field_seek() | 이 함수는 행 열쇠를 주어진 열 이동량으로 설정합니다. | 5 |
64 | mysqli_field_tell() | 그는 반환 필드 커서의 위치를 반환합니다. | 5 |
65 | mysqli_free_result() | 그는 결과와 연결된 메모리를 해제합니다. | 5 |
66 | mysqli_num_fields() | 그는 결과 집합에서의 필드 수를 반환합니다. | 5 |
67 | mysqli_num_rows() | 그는 결과 집합에서의 행 수를 반환합니다. | 5 |
68 | mysqli_stmt_sqlstate() | 그는 마지막 문장에서 SQLSTATE 오류를 반환합니다. | 5 |
69 | mysqli_stmt_affected_rows() | 최근 실행된 문장이 영향을 미친(변경, 삭제, 삽입) 행 수를 반환합니다. | 5 |
70 | mysqli_stmt_attr_get() | 문장의 주어진 속성의 현재 값을 반환합니다. | 5 |
71 | mysqli_stmt_attr_set() | 이 함수를 사용하여 문장에 다양한 속성을 설정하여 동작을 변경할 수 있습니다. | 5 |
72 | mysqli_stmt_bind_param() | 변수를 준비된 문장의 파라미터 태그에 바인딩합니다. | 5 |
73 | mysqli_stmt_bind_result() | 결과 객체의 열을 변수에 바인딩합니다. | 5 |
74 | mysqli_stmt_close() | 문장 객체를 닫습니다. | 5 |
75 | mysqli_stmt_data_seek() | 결과 객체의 행을 검색하는 데 사용됩니다. | 5 |
76 | mysqli_stmt_errno() | 최근 실행된 문장에서 발생한 오류 코드를 반환합니다. | 5 |
77 | mysqli_stmt_error() | 최근 실행된 문장에서 발생한 오류의 설명을 반환합니다. | 5 |
78 | mysqli_stmt_execute() | 문장을 실행합니다. | 5 |
79 | mysqli_stmt_fetch() | 결과의 열을 지정된 변수에 추출합니다. | 5 |
80 | mysqli_stmt_field_count() | 주어진 문장 결과에서 필드 수를 반환합니다. | 5 |
81 | mysqli_stmt_free_result() | 문장 결과를 저장한 메모리를 해제하는 데 사용됩니다. | 5 |
82 | mysqli_stmt_get_result() | 문장의 결과를 반환합니다. | 5 |
83 | mysqli_stmt_num_rows() | 문장 결과에서 행 수를 반환합니다. | 5 |
84 | mysqli_stmt_param_count() | 준비된 문장에서 파라미터 태그의 수를 반환합니다. | 5 |
85 | mysqli_stmt_prepare() | SQL 문을 실행하려면 여기서 파라미터 태그(“?” 대체 기호)를 사용할 수 있습니다. | 5 |
86 | mysqli_stmt_reset() | 에러를 재설정하고, 버퍼되지 않은 결과 집합과 전송된 데이터를 초기화합니다. | 5 |
87 | mysqli_stmt_result_metadata() | 메타데이터 객체를 반환합니다. 이 객체는 문장 결과에 대한 정보를 저장합니다. | 5 |
88 | mysqli_stmt_send_long_data() | 테이블의 특정 열이 BLOB 유형의 TEXT라면, 이 함수는 데이터를 그 열로 분할 전송합니다. | 5 |
89 | mysqli_stmt_store_result() | 지역에 문장 객체 결과를 저장하는 데 사용됩니다. | 5 |